画そうのサイズを取得する。
このとき画像のPathに注意が必要です。
SERVER_ROOT ではなく、DOCUMENT_ROOT で指定しましょう。
list($width, $height, $type, $attr) = getimagesize($_SERVER[DOCUMENT_ROOT]."/upload/save_image/".$item4[main_image].".jpg"); echo 'W:'.$width.' H:'.$height.'<br>';
画像の最大サイズを調整する。
$wid_max = '450'; $hei_max = '450'; if($width >= $height){ if($width <= $wid_max){ $html_size = ' width="'.$width.'"'; }else{ $html_size = ' width="'.$wid_max.'"'; } }else{ if($height <= $hei_max){ $html_size = ' height="'.$height.'"'; }else{ $html_size = ' height="'.$hti_max.'"'; } } $img_html = '<img src="/upload/save_image/'.$item4[comment6].'.jpg"'.$html_size.'>'; echo $img_html;